Shimla: The Gateway to the Himalayas: 

Your road trip begins in the charming hill station of Shimla, often referred to as the "Queen of the Hills." Take a stroll along the famous Mall Road, visit the iconic Christ Church, and soak in the colonial-era architecture that transports you back in time. Don't miss the opportunity to explore the scenic spots around Shimla, such as Kufri, Chail, and Mashobra, before you set off on your journey towards Kinnaur.

Sarahan: Gateway to Kinnaur's Cultural Splendor: 

As you venture further into the Himalayas, you'll reach Sarahan, the gateway to the Kinnaur district. This picturesque village is home to the revered Bhimakali Temple, an architectural gem dedicated to the goddess Bhimakali. Immerse yourself in the spiritual aura of the temple and witness the intricate wood carvings and exquisite craftsmanship. The panoramic views of the surrounding mountains and the lush valleys will leave you awestruck.

Sangla Valley: Nature's Paradise: 

Continuing your road trip, the next stop is the breathtaking Sangla Valley, also known as the "Baspa Valley." Encircled by snow-capped mountains and apple orchards, this valley offers stunning vistas at every turn. Explore the quaint villages of Chitkul and Rakcham, interact with the friendly locals, and savor the delicious local cuisine. Take leisurely walks along the Baspa River, breathe in the fresh mountain air, and let the serene beauty of the valley captivate your senses.

Kalpa: Where Mountains Meet Mythology: 

Next on your itinerary is the picturesque town of Kalpa, located at the foothills of the majestic Kinner Kailash range. Revel in the awe-inspiring views of snow-capped peaks, including the sacred Kinner Kailash peak. Visit the ancient Narayan-Nagini temple, adorned with intricate carvings, and immerse yourself in the spiritual ambiance. Indulge in local Kinnauri delicacies and witness a breathtaking sunset painting the mountains in hues of gold and crimson.

Nako: A Tranquil Lakeside Retreat: 

As you approach the end of your road trip, you'll reach the tranquil village of Nako. Nestled by the banks of Nako Lake, this village offers a serene and meditative atmosphere. Explore the ancient Nako Monastery, adorned with murals and statues, and soak in the peaceful ambiance. The shimmering blue waters of the lake against the backdrop of snow-capped peaks create a picturesque setting that's perfect for quiet contemplation and relaxation.
